Job Description Summary

Lead the strategic and operational management of GoldSeal products across the MICT portfolio, with a focus on product quality, cost optimization, growth acceleration, lifecycle planning, and serviceability. Drive cross-functional alignment and transparent communication across Service, Equipment, and segment leadership to ensure business objectives are met.

Job Description

Essential Responsibilities

Quality

  • Monitor and analyze product quality metrics; initiate corrective actions and report progress to GoldSeal to segment leadership.

  • Investigate customer complaints and CSOs; collaborate with engineering and service teams to resolve issues and enhance customer satisfaction.

  • Champion component reuse strategies that uphold the integrity and certification standards of systems.

Cost

  • Evaluate standard cost structures and lead initiatives to improve contribution margin and market competitiveness.

  • Manage aging inventory and asset disposition to optimize inventory turns and meet operational performance targets.

  • Define product standards that balance profitability with compelling Blue Book values, supporting upgrade strategies for key product returns.

Growth

  • Develop and execute growth strategies for GoldSeal, focusing on assets from trades and lease returns.

  • Forecast demand and lead NPI planning based on installed base trends and retirement patterns, in collaboration with regional teams.

  • Own end-to-end NPI execution: business case development, catalog creation, costing, engineering and regulatory documentation, qualification, and quoting models.

  • Approve NPI scope, schedules, milestone reviews, and supporting documentation.

  • Lead PSI planning for GoldSeal lifecycle management and participate in EOL milestone reviews.

  • Partner with Service Marketing to create impactful product collateral & maintain accurate web content.

  • Collaborate with global refurbishment centers to ensure consistent product quality and throughput aligned with quarterly business goals.

Service

  • Track on-time delivery performance; review PSI, order backlog, and shipment commitments with production teams.

  • Advocate for GoldSeal product reliability and service excellence with Sales and Field Engineering teams.

  • Define & publish Blue Book values and S2 PSI plans to guide purchasing and trade-in pricing in TiX.

  • Integrate with segment  teams to align EOPL milestone timing (M7/M8) with global installed base transitions.

  • Optimize inventory management and support trade pricing decisions through demand forecasting and retirement analysis.

Communication

  • Foster strong, ongoing collaboration with Service, Sales, Modality, and Lifecycle Solutions teams to align on regional and global priorities and deliver operational performance.
